Output 17d057b08fa4eccd036f9a0c65ea752eac54c230573a24d314e527c85b51e816:0

value
45306649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 329e52cf535d73e6ac8c82f43935abc44b92fd20 OP_EQUAL
address
36JfNeG7rEpQr1KWZBaN2X3yNxs2HcsN22
transaction
17d057b08fa4eccd036f9a0c65ea752eac54c230573a24d314e527c85b51e816
confirmations
325667
spent
true